Candidates must pass graduation with at least 60% aggregate or first class to apply for VIT Chennai M.Tech programme. Aspirants appearing for their final degree exam/ final semester exam in the current year are also eligible to apply. Aspirants must secure 60% and above or equivalent CGPA in Class 10, Class 12, diploma/ UG/ PG degree to apply for M.Tech programme.

Candidates must complete Class 12 with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ics/ Biology with at least 60% aggregate (50% aggregate for SC/ ST and applicants hailing from Jammu & Kashmir, Ladakh and the North Eastern states of Arunachal Pradesh, Assam, Manipur, Meghalaya, Mizoram, Nagaland, Sikkim and Tripura.) to apply for VIT Chennai BTech programme.
Age Limit
Candidates whose date of birth falls on or after 1st July 2003 are eligible to apply for VITEEE-2025.Candidates who fail to produce this certificate in original as proof of their age at the time of counselling, shall stand disqualified.

In order to get admission at Vellore Institute of Technology Chennai, candidates must sit and appear for entrance exam as per respective courses. Aspirants must also fulfil the eligibility requirements for admission. Below is the eligibility criteria for top VIT Chennai courses:
Popular Courses | Common Eligibility |
---|---|
BE/ BTech | Class 12 with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ics/ Biology with at least 60% aggregate (50% aggregate for SC/ ST and applicants hailing from Jammu & Kashmir, Ladakh and the North Eastern states of Arunachal Pradesh, Assam, Manipur, Meghalaya, Mizoram, Nagaland, Sikkim and Tripura.) |
BTech in Fashion Technology | Class 12 with a 60% aggregate in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ics |
BSc Fashion Design | Class 12 with a 60% aggregate |
MCA | UG degree with a minimum of 60% aggregate or first-class |
MBA/ PGDM | UG or integrated degree with a minimum of 60% aggregate or first class (50% aggregate for SC/ ST and applicants hailing from Jammu & Kashmir, Ladakh and the North Eastern states of Arunachal Pradesh, Assam, Manipur, Meghalaya, Mizoram, Nagaland, Sikkim and Tripura) |
BCom (Hons) | Class 12 with Accountancy / Commerce / Mathematics as one of the subjects with at least 70% aggregate (60% aggregate for SC/ ST and applicants hailing from Jammu & Kashmir, Ladakh and the North Eastern states of Arunachal Pradesh, Assam, Manipur, Meghalaya, Mizoram, Nagaland, Sikkim and Tripura) |
PhD | Master's degree in relevant discipline with a minimum of 60% aggregate or a CGPA 6.5 on a 10-point scale |
PG Law | Class 12 with a minimum overall aggregate of 55% in the UG Law Programme |

General category candidates must have secured a minimum aggregate of 60% in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ics/Biology in their class 12th examination.
SC/ST candidates from specific regions need to score a minimum of 50% in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ics/Biology.
Applicants should have studied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ics/Biology as compulsory subjects in their class 12th examination.
The applicant's date of birth should fall on or after July 1, 2002.
Candidates must be Indian Nationals/PIO/OCI.
NRI applicants can apply directly under the NRI category.
